The Government has launched the "Guaranteed Employment Program" earlier, which will accept applications from May 25th to the deadline of June 14. The government announced today (13th) the list of the fourth batch of employers receiving wage subsidies, the amount of wage subsidies and the number of employees promised to be paid, involving about 11,000 employers. The total amount of wage subsidies was about 6.27 billion yuan and the number of employees promised to be about 27 Million. In the fourth batch of the list, the first two to receive the most subsidies are Cathay Pacific and KMB. Together with catering, service and other companies, Cathay Pacific has received a total of more than 500 million yuan; KMB has received more than 324 million yuan.

There have been five batches of about 110,000 employers receiving subsidies involving about 29.5 billion yuan. A 

government spokesman said that together with the first three batches of published employer lists, the secretariat has announced four batches of about 100,000 recipients since June 22 List of employers and related information on wage subsidies. In addition, the fifth batch of approximately 9,000 employers who successfully applied for the payment of wage subsidies began today. The amount of subsidies involved is about 4.1 billion yuan, and the number of paid employees is about 190,000. In other words, there have been five batches of about 110,000 employers receiving wage subsidies, covering about 1.3 million employees, involving wage subsidies of about 29.5 billion yuan.

In the fourth batch of lists, many large enterprises made the list. Its China Thai Airways Co., Ltd. received about 458 million and promised 17,703 paid employees. In addition, Cathay Pacific Catering Services (Hong Kong) Co., Ltd. also received about 43 million yuan. It promised 1,590 paid employees and Cathay Pacific Service Co., Ltd. received a contract 17 million yuan, 646 employees promised to be paid, in other words, Cathay Pacific received at least 519 million yuan subsidies. In addition, Dragonair, a subsidiary of Cathay Pacific Airways, also received about 69 million, with 2,581 salaried employees.
